Heads up before reviewing PRs touching `ThumbGrid`: the image cache in Lanternfish retains decoded bitmaps past eviction because listeners hold strong references. Fix landed in the `cache-weakref` branch; anything reintroducing direct bitmap refs should be rejected. Watch for allocations inside `onScroll` callbacks and any cache writes outside `CacheGuard`. Heap snapshots from the Brindle test rig show the leak plateauing around 400MB after 10 minutes of scrolling. Reproduction steps, snapshot diffs, and the ownership rules are documented here.

runbook for badug-kadup: https://confluence.zemvarlabs.internal/projects/browse/display/projects/bd1b

Ticket: Staging env misconfigured for Siftgate bloom filter

The bloom layer in front of the Pellet KV store is rejecting all lookups in staging because the env file was copied from the dev template without credentials. False-positive tuning values are fine; only the auth line is missing. To unblock the weekly demo, the Pellet admission secret must be set on the following line.

env line for yaguf-fajop: LEDGER_TOKEN13=fb08984397349

Hey — quick handover before I'm out. The Quillgate canary gating rules are mostly automated now: a canary gets promoted only if error rate and p95 latency stay inside the thresholds for 30 minutes. If metrics are borderline, the gate holds rather than rolls back, so check the dashboard before forcing anything. Marit owns the alerting side. The gate currently runs with these thresholds.

settings of tagef-bawif:
DRUIX_HOST=druix.zemvarlabs.internal
DRUIX_PORT=8000